(2015-05-27, 10:26)eltopo Wrote: I don't know of any projector with a 2.35:1 (21:9) resolution, I think they all are 16:9.
If this skin needs a physical 21:9 resolution like those widescreen monitors, I guess this won't work with projectors.
I think for projector support we would need a 16:9 skin, but with all GUI elements placed inside 800px height (if full HD). And this 800px height GUI would have to be moved to the upper end and the lower end of the screen (like it is possible today with the vertical height setting when watching a 21:9 movie).
But I don't know if this is something BigNoid can support in this skin.
